		<description>I'm a fiend with my calculator and log sheets. I have a legal ledger that is nothing but addition lines. ;) I weight, I measure and I look up info. It's easy on anything packaged, but fresh fruits and veggies and meat can be pretty tough.

There's a great site called nutritiondata.com that has an amazing index of food and the calories and other nutritional info associated with them. If I go out to eat, I try to hit places that make their nutritional information public so I can make good choices.

With cereal, you just have to watch which one you pick. Some cereals, like rice krispies are not even remotely filling. Other cereals, like Kashi GoLean Crunch are astonishingly filling, even if you only go with the actual serving size.

The thing that has worked best for me is focusing on protein and fiber. If you aim to get 25 grams of fiber a day and at least 75 grams of protein a day, you'll find you're eating pretty filing food. :)</description>
